Carter Nelson: Looking Out Week 03
The interior of an old water tower in the Netherlands has been transformed by Zecc Architecten. Located at a national park, the staircase serves an observation deck that overlooks the park. The use of wood within the cold concrete structure gives a degree of warmth and really highlights the materials used in this interior. The staircases bounce up the walls of the cylindrical water tower interior in a way that engages someone who engages with this project.
